+ driver (from the BootUtil distribution) can be embedded in the OVMF image at\r
+ build time:\r
+\r
+ - Download BootUtil:\r
+ - Navigate to\r
+ https://downloadcenter.intel.com/download/19186/Ethernet-Intel-Ethernet-Connections-Boot-Utility-Preboot-Images-and-EFI-Drivers\r
+ - Click the download link for "PREBOOT.EXE".\r
+ - Accept the Intel Software License Agreement that appears.\r
+ - Unzip "PREBOOT.EXE" into a separate directory (this works with the\r
+ "unzip" utility on platforms different from Windows as well).\r
+ - Copy the "APPS/EFI/EFIx64/E3522X2.EFI" driver binary to\r
+ "Intel3.5/EFIX64/E3522X2.EFI" in your WORKSPACE.\r
+ - Intel have stopped distributing an IA32 driver binary (which used to\r
+ match the filename pattern "E35??E2.EFI"), thus this method will only\r
+ work for the IA32X64 and X64 builds of OVMF.\r
